Transaction 000583c81ecd34c10d5fdd3bf554244f432dad21a11668245bf7b1e23c830a59
1 Input
1 Output
-
000583c81ecd34c10d5fdd3bf554244f432dad21a11668245bf7b1e23c830a59:0
- value
- 637252
- script pubkey
- OP_0 OP_PUSHBYTES_20 f5fe8da1bb95b4b26678f63b57758da13d167ea9
- address
- bc1q7hlgmgdmjk6tyenc7ca4wavd5y73vl4f6ryqh4